頑健な注釈なし動画同期手法(Learning Robust Video Synchronization without Annotations)

田中専務

拓海先生、最近部署で動画を使った品質監視や現場記録の活用を進めろと言われまして、同じ場所で撮った別日の映像を時間を合わせて比較したいんですけど、どうも人手で合わせるのは現実的でないと感じております。これって要するに自動で時間を合わせる技術が必要ということですか?

AIメンター拓海

素晴らしい着眼点ですね!まさにその通りです。今回扱う論文は、ラベル(人手で付けた正解)なしで異なる映像同士の時間位置を揃える技術を示しているんですよ。大丈夫、一緒にやれば必ずできますよ。まずは何が問題かを一緒に整理しましょうか。

田中専務

問題点を端的に教えていただけますか。現場では天候や季節やカメラ位置が少し違うだけで見た目が全然違う。こういうのを同じ時間だと判定するのは難しいのではないかと危惧しています。

AIメンター拓海

その通りです。ここで重要なのは見た目そのものではなく、映像の中にある共通の“出来事”や“動き”を抽出して比較することです。要点を三つにまとめます。第一にラベル無しで学ぶ点、第二に映像の外観変化に頑健な表現を学ぶ点、第三に大規模データを自動で扱える点です。

田中専務

ラベル無しで学ぶ、というのは工場でいうと検査結果を毎回手で付けずに機械が勝手に学ぶようなものですか。人を雇ってラベルを付けるコストを抑えられるなら現実的に導入できそうです。

AIメンター拓海

そうです。具体的には自己教師あり学習(self-supervised learning(SSL)自己教師あり学習)という考え方に近いです。映像自身が持つ構造を利用して正解の代わりに学習信号を作ります。これにより大規模な手作業ラベル付けを不要にできますよ。

田中専務

経営的にはそこが肝心でして。初期投資と運用コストで言うと、人手で合わせるのとこの技術を入れるのとどちらが得か具体的に掴みたい。導入後の工数削減の目安はありますか。

AIメンター拓海

大丈夫、一緒に要点を三つで考えましょう。第一に初期投資は開発または外部サービス導入の費用だが、二年目以降の人件費削減で回収できるケースが多いです。第二に現場運用はモデルの更新頻度とデータ管理次第で変わる。第三にリスクは誤同期による判断ミスだが、検査プロセスにヒューマンインザループを残せば安全に回せますよ。

田中専務

それを聞くと現実味が出ます。ただ現場は色々とバラエティがあります。屋外の天候変化や夜間作業、カメラアングルの違い。こうした違いをこの手法はどの程度吸収できるのでしょうか。

AIメンター拓海

良い質問です。論文のアプローチは見た目(外観)に依存しない特徴(feature(特徴量))を学ぶ点が肝です。つまり季節や照明が変わっても、動きや構造といった本質的情報でフレームを対応付けます。結果的に屋外や時間変化に強い性能を出しています。

田中専務

これって要するに見た目の違いを無視して、『いつ何が起きたか』を揃える技術ということでしょうか?

AIメンター拓海

まさにその通りですよ。端的に言えば『出来事の時間軸を揃える』ことが目的です。そのために映像からフレームごとのベクトル表現を学び、類似するベクトル同士を対応させる手順を取ります。専門用語を避けると、映像の”要点”を数値にして比較するイメージです。

田中専務

導入の現実面で最後にもう一つ。うちの現場はネットワークが弱いところもありクラウド頼みだと不安なのですが、オンプレミスで動かすことはできますか。

AIメンター拓海

大丈夫、オンプレミス運用も想定できますよ。モデルの学習は比較的計算が要るため初期はGPUが必要だが、学習済みモデルを現場に配布して推論だけを軽量デバイスで行う運用が現実的です。セキュリティ面でも安心感がありますね。

田中専務

わかりました。では最後に私の理解を言わせてください。要するに『人の手で同期を付けなくても、映像の中にある出来事の特徴を学んで、別撮り映像同士の時間を自動で揃えられる技術』ということで合っていますか。もし合っていれば、まずは試験導入の計画を相談させてください。

AIメンター拓海

素晴らしい要約です!大丈夫、一緒に小さなPoC(Proof of Concept)から始めて、費用対効果を検証していきましょう。失敗も学びになるので安心してくださいね。


1. 概要と位置づけ

結論から言う。注釈(ラベル)を与えずに複数のビデオ間で正確な時間対応を自動的に算出する技術は、現場業務の動画活用を劇的に現実的にする。従来は手作業や外部同期信号に頼っていたため、異なる天候や季節、照明の差がある長尺動画同士の比較はコストと時間の面で困難であった。今回提示された手法は、映像そのものが持つ時間的・構造的な手がかりを利用してフレーム間の非線形な時間対応を学習し、ラベル無しで大規模データを扱う点で既存手法を拡張する。

まず背景を整理する。ビデオ同期はVideo Synchronization(ビデオ同期)であり、同一シーンを別時刻に撮影した映像を時間的に揃える作業である。工場の点検記録や保守ログ、監視映像など応用範囲は広い。従来法は局所的な特徴マッチングや外部タイムコード、GPSなどに依存していたが、屋内や多数の消費者カメラで取得した動画にはこうした明示的同期がないことが多い。したがって人手のラベルに頼らない自律的な同期機構が求められる。

本手法の位置づけは、自己管理で学習データを生成しつつ、映像間の時間対応を非線形に求める点にある。言い換えれば、人の目で合わせる作業を機械に委ね、外観差を超えて『出来事の発生順序』を基準に合わせる技術である。これは単なるピクセル比較ではなく、映像の高次元表現を用いる点で既存の古典的手法と質的に異なる。

経営的な意義は明快だ。手作業での同期にかかる人件費を削減でき、映像資産を二次利用して異常検知や工程改善に回すことでROI(Return on Investment、投資収益率)を改善できる。まずは小規模なPoCで評価し、効果が見えれば段階的に導入を拡大する現実的な道筋が描ける。

検索に使える英語キーワード: “video synchronization”, “temporal alignment”, “self-supervised video representation”。

2. 先行研究との差別化ポイント

本手法が最も変えた点は、明示的な同期信号や大量の手作業ラベルに依存しない点である。従来研究は局所的なディスクリプタマッチングやオプティカルフローに基づく手法、あるいはGPSやオーディオ指紋など収集時に付与される同期情報に依存していた。これらは装置の精度や屋外条件に左右され、全天候型の大規模な適用には限界があった。

また深層学習を用いるアプローチは存在するが、多くは大量のラベルデータを前提としており、映像ごとのフレーム単位の厳密な対応を作るには非効率だった。今回のアプローチは映像の内在的な時間的整合性を利用して自己管理でラベルに相当する信号を生成するため、学習データのスケールが桁違いでも実用的に扱える点で差別化される。

具体的には、外観変化(天候、照明、季節)に対して不変な特徴表現を学ぶことで、長尺の異時刻動画同士でも信頼できる対応を導き出す。これは単純なフレーム間の類似度計算を超え、時間的な一貫性(temporal consistency)をモデル化することで実現される。したがって適用範囲は監視、保守、行動解析から映像編集支援まで広い。

経営判断に直結する差異は二つある。第一に運用コストの低減である。ラベル作成の人件費が不要になることでスケールが取りやすい。第二に導入の柔軟性である。外部同期が存在しない既存資産にも適用でき、既存の映像データを資産として活用可能にする点が企業価値を高める。

検索に使える英語キーワード: “unsupervised video alignment”, “appearance-invariant features”, “temporal consistency learning”。

3. 中核となる技術的要素

中核技術は学習済みのフレーム表現を使って非線形な時間対応を求める点にある。ここで用いられる主要概念としては、Representation Learning(表現学習)とSequence Matching(シーケンス整合)である。表現学習は各フレームを高次元ベクトルに写像し、類似イベントが近くに位置するように学ぶ手法である。工場で言えば各瞬間の”報告書”を数値化して比較するようなものである。

学習は自己教師ありのループで行われる。まず現在のモデルでフレーム同士の粗い対応を見つけ、それを利用してより良い教師信号を生成し、モデルを更新する。この反復によりモデルは徐々に自分で扱えるデータの質を上げていく。重要なのは手作業ラベルに頼らないことと、誤った対応に対してロバスト(頑健)である点だ。

具体的なアルゴリズム構成要素としては、まず映像フレームを入力とし、Convolutional Neural Networks (CNN)(畳み込みニューラルネットワーク)等で局所・大域情報を抽出する。次に各フレームの特徴ベクトル間の距離行列を計算し、動的時間伸縮(Dynamic Time Warpingに類する処理)で整合路を求める。ここでの工夫が非線形な対応を可能にしている。

実装上の配慮点は計算量とメモリである。本手法は大規模データを扱うため、特徴抽出と類似度計算をスケーラブルに設計する必要がある。実務上はバッチ処理や近似探索、学習済みモデルの蒸留(distillation)などを併用して軽量化を図るのが現実的である。

検索に使える英語キーワード: “feature embedding”, “dynamic time warping”, “self-supervised representation”。

4. 有効性の検証方法と成果

検証は多数の現実世界映像ペアを用いた定量評価と可視化によって行われる。評価指標はフレーム単位の一致率や最大誤差時間であり、従来法やGPS/タイムコード付きデータでの結果と比較される。重要なのは長尺映像や外観変化が大きいケースでの耐性を示す点である。

本手法はラベル無しデータセットで学習しつつ、数千万フレーム規模のデータで堅牢に動作する点が示された。これは既存のラベル付き学習法と比較して、手間を大幅に減らしながら同等以上の同期精度を達成した事実を意味する。特に季節変化や昼夜差があるシーンでの成績改善が顕著である。

また実験では、従来の局所ディスクリプタベース手法が長尺かつ外観差の大きいケースで崩れる一方、本手法は整合性を維持していた。これは特徴表現が外観要素に依存しない性質を獲得しているためだ。産業用途では誤同期による誤検知リスクを抑えつつ、既存映像資産の再利用が可能になった。

ただし検証は学術データセット中心であり、特定の産業現場固有の条件(カメラの激しい揺れや極端な被写界深度差)に対する評価は限定的である。現場導入前には実データでのPoCを必ず行い、精度や運用負荷を定量的に把握する必要がある。

検索に使える英語キーワード: “evaluation metrics for synchronization”, “large-scale video benchmark”, “appearance-invariant alignment”。

5. 研究を巡る議論と課題

この分野の議論点は主に三つある。第一はラベル無し学習の信頼性である。自己生成された教師信号は誤りを含みうるため、誤伝播を抑える設計が必須だ。第二は計算資源とスケーラビリティである。大規模映像の類似度計算はメモリと計算負荷が高く、実装の工夫が求められる。第三は現場への適用範囲と限界である。例えば完全に屋内の固定カメラなら従来法で十分なこともあり、投資対効果を慎重に判断する必要がある。

さらに技術的にはカメラの大きな視点差や極端な被写体遮蔽に対する頑健性が課題である。こうしたケースでは映像だけで対応困難な場合があり、センサフュージョン(複数センサの統合)が必要となる可能性がある。ビジネス観点ではデータ管理、プライバシー、長期保守の契約設計が重要である。

また研究コミュニティでは、どの程度の自律性を許容するかが実務上の論点になる。完全自動で判断してしまうと誤判定の責任範囲が不明確になるため、ヒューマンインザループ(Human-in-the-loop)を残す運用設計が現場では現実的だ。これが導入障壁を下げる一方で運用コストとのトレードオフを生む。

最後に透明性と説明可能性の問題がある。経営判断で使うにはアルゴリズムの結果がどう出たかを説明できることが望ましい。ブラックボックス的な挙動をそのまま運用するのではなく、異常ケースの可視化や説明機構を併設することが推奨される。

検索に使える英語キーワード: “robustness to occlusion”, “scalability of video matching”, “human-in-the-loop for video analysis”。

6. 今後の調査・学習の方向性

今後の研究・実務検討は三つのレイヤーで進めるべきだ。第一にアルゴリズム改善として、極端な視点差や部分的な遮蔽に対するロバスト性を高める研究が必要である。ここではマルチビュー学習や自己生成タスクの工夫が鍵となる。第二に実装面での軽量化と近似探索技術の導入により、現場運用のコストを下げる努力が求められる。

第三に業務プロセスとの統合だ。単に技術を入れるだけでなく、検査フローや異常対応手順に合わせたヒューマンインタフェース、エスカレーションルールの設計を行う必要がある。これにより誤同期があった場合でも安全に運用しつつ効果を享受できる。

教育・学習の観点では、経営層や現場管理者がこの技術の限界と期待値を正しく理解するための啓蒙が重要である。導入前に短期のPoCを回し、数値で投資対効果を示すことが意思決定を容易にする。技術的な実装は外部ベンダーと協業する場合でも、評価指標を自社で定めることが重要だ。

最後に産業適用ではデータガバナンスと継続的なモデルメンテナンスの仕組みが必須である。モデルの劣化を監視し、定期的な再学習やデータリークの管理をルール化することで、長期的な運用安定性を確保できる。これらを含めたロードマップを早期に策定することを勧める。

検索に使える英語キーワード: “multi-view learning for alignment”, “efficient nearest neighbor search for videos”, “model maintenance and drift monitoring”。

会議で使えるフレーズ集

「この技術はラベル付けの人件費を削減して既存の映像資産を活用できるポテンシャルがあります。」

「まずは小規模PoCで同期精度と運用コストを測り、回収期間を見積もりましょう。」

「現場に導入する際はヒューマンインザループを残し、説明可能性のある可視化を必須にします。」

P. Wieschollek, I. Freeman, H.P.A. Lensch, “Learning Robust Video Synchronization without Annotations,” arXiv preprint arXiv:1610.05985v3, 2017.

AIBRプレミアム

関連する記事

AI Business Reviewをもっと見る

今すぐ購読し、続きを読んで、すべてのアーカイブにアクセスしましょう。

続きを読む